Game - NT: Parable of the Good Samaritan - To help or not to help?

A fun and interactive Bible game that focusses on helping those in need

This activity involves a game and a role-play, where the priest and the Levite will defend their actions for not helping the wounded man, while the children playing the role of the Samaritan will argue for the importance of showing compassion.

This idea is part of a comprehensive Sunday school lesson focusing on Jesus' parable of the Good Samaritan, as recounted in Luke 10: 30-37.
